The presence of intelligent tools, both in the digital and physical realms, is progressively enhancing our capacities to act on personal, organizational, national, and international levels, leading to both intended and unintended consequences. Collectively, these changes are reshaping our world at a speed and scale that necessitate earnest consideration. In the midst of uncertainty, the development and utilization of these new capabilities would greatly benefit from CyberSystemic approaches and methods of learning.

The book drives readers to adopt a different - CyberSystemic approach, moving beyond perceiving individuals merely as subjects or consumers to recognizing them as citizens. This shift implies an active role in constructing organizations and social policies as conversational networks wherein individuals collectively contribute to the formulation of purposes and products. The editors put forward concepts and examples that illuminate and exemplify these perspectives on citizenship in organizational and social contexts.

Readers will discover several conceptual frameworks and usage cases of CyberSystemic methodologies in various fields, providing the first look at the latest development of the grey methodology and the AI relation to individuals and governance and will provide the first discussion on the General Interactions theory.

Igor Perko is currently serving as an Associate Professor at the University of Maribor, Faculty of Economics and Business in Slovenia.

Raul Espejo is President of the World Organization of Systems and Cybernetics (WOSC) and Director of Syncho Research, UK.

Alfonso Reyes is the chancellor of Universidad de Ibagué. He is a physicist and a systems engineer from Los Andes University.
